diff options
author | Iwan Timmer | 2015-06-12 20:14:14 +0200 |
---|---|---|
committer | Iwan Timmer | 2015-06-12 20:14:14 +0200 |
commit | cbd9e301f42e509c092613620e01d40d956b366e (patch) | |
tree | f3885f6dbd654f3c68c43c6f7075f26b4f6522d1 | |
download | aur-cbd9e301f42e509c092613620e01d40d956b366e.tar.gz |
Initial commit of Moonlight Embedded
-rw-r--r-- | .SRCINFO | 28 | ||||
-rw-r--r-- | PKGBUILD | 29 |
2 files changed, 57 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O new file mode 100644 index 000000000000..1ec2e92bfa42 --- /dev/null +++ b/.SRCINFO @@ -0,0 +1,28 @@ +# Generated by makepkg 4.2.1 +# Fri Jun 12 18:11:20 UTC 2015 +pkgbase = moonlight-embedded + pkgdesc = Gamestream client for embedded devices + pkgver = 2.0 + pkgrel = 1 + url = https://github.com/irtimmer/moonlight-embedded + arch = armv6h + arch = armv7h + license = GPL + makedepends = cmake + depends = curl + depends = opus + depends = alsa-lib + depends = avahi + depends = curl + depends = libevdev + depends = libsystemd + optdepends = raspberrypi-firmware-tools: Raspberry Pi support + optdepends = imx-vpu: i.MX6 support + source = https://github.com/irtimmer/moonlight-embedded/releases/download/v2.0/moonlight-embedded-2.0.tar.xz + sha256sums = 5671b6c5b33357ea2a2e2882d42e852590983f55fd6779eb0d2de1f08f0226b5 + makedepends_armv6h = raspberrypi-firmware-tools + makedepends_armv7h = raspberrypi-firmware-tools + makedepends_armv7h = imx-vpu + +pkgname = moonlight-embedded + di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..0c4509c0e960 --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,29 @@ +# Maintainer: Iwan Timmer <irtimmer@gmail.com> + +pkgname=moonlight-embedded +pkgver=2.0 +pkgrel=1 +pkgdesc="Gamestream client for embedded devices" +arch=('armv6h' 'armv7h') +url="https://github.com/irtimmer/moonlight-embedded" +license=('GPL') +depends=('curl' 'opus' 'alsa-lib' 'avahi' 'curl' 'libevdev' 'libsystemd') +makedepends_armv7h=('raspberrypi-firmware-tools' 'imx-vpu') +makedepends_armv6h=('raspberrypi-firmware-tools') +optdepends=('raspberrypi-firmware-tools: Raspberry Pi support' + 'imx-vpu: i.MX6 support') +makedepends=('cmake') +source=("https://github.com/irtimmer/moonlight-embedded/releases/download/v$pkgver/$pkgname-$pkgver.tar.xz") +sha256sums=('5671b6c5b33357ea2a2e2882d42e852590983f55fd6779eb0d2de1f08f0226b5') + +build() { + mkdir -p build + cd build + cmake ../moonlight-embedded-$pkgver -DCMAKE_INSTALL_PREFIX=/usr -DCMAKE_BUILD_TYPE=Release + make +} + +package() { + cd build + make DESTDIR="$pkgdir/" install +} |